一、数据法学就业方向?
数据法学大体包括三个方面的内容:
一是技术,即大数据和算法对法律运行机制的影响分析,包括对立法、执法、司法、守法等环节的科学分析,以及对法治评估的影响;
二是实体,即法律对于数据及其流转过程的保护或规制,以及通过数据实现的社会治理;
三是方法,即如何通过大数据来推进法学研究本身,包括数据时代对传统法学概念与原理的挑战及其回应。 据此,已出现的那些学科或方向都不足以涵盖以上内容。
网络在今天固然是数据运行的环境,但网络法学研究的某些对象(如网络犯罪、网络侵权等,涉及的其实是网络条件下的传统实体法问题)未必就是数据法学的研究对象,也没有突出数据本身的核心地位。 信息法学与数据法学较为接近,因为信息就是数据所包含的意义,与数据往往不可分割。
就业方向还不是很清楚的,律师、专利代理、知识产权类应该都可以
二、java 大数据方向
Java在大数据方向的应用
随着互联网时代的到来,大数据已经成为现代社会中无法回避的一个重要方向。在处理海量数据、分析数据、实现智能决策上,Java在大数据领域发挥着重要的作用。本文将介绍Java在大数据方向的应用及其优势。
1. Java与大数据
作为一门广泛应用于企业级开发的编程语言,Java具备许多适用于大数据处理的优势。首先,Java具有跨平台的特性,可以在不同的操作系统上运行,这使得Java成为处理大数据的理想语言。其次,Java有丰富的类库和框架支持,如Hadoop、Spark和Flink等,这些工具能够帮助开发人员更高效地处理和分析大规模数据集。此外,Java还提供了强大的多线程和并发编程特性,使得在大数据处理过程中能够更好地利用系统资源,提高处理效率。
2. Java在大数据处理中的角色
在大数据处理中,Java可以扮演不同的角色,包括数据的读取、数据清洗、数据分析和数据存储等。下面将对这些角色逐一进行介绍。
2.1 数据的读取
在大数据处理过程中,数据的读取是首要任务。Java可以通过各种方式读取数据,如从文件系统读取数据、从数据库获取数据以及从实时数据源接收数据等。Java提供了众多的类库和API,如Apache Hadoop的InputFormat和OutputFormat等,可以方便地进行数据读取和写入操作。
2.2 数据清洗
大数据往往包含大量的噪声和冗余数据,因此在进行数据分析之前需要对数据进行清洗。Java提供了丰富的字符串处理工具和正则表达式库,可以帮助开发人员轻松地处理和清洗文本数据。此外,Java的面向对象特性和异常处理机制也能够提高代码的可读性和健壮性,有助于开发人员编写灵活和可靠的数据清洗算法。
2.3 数据分析
数据分析是大数据处理中最关键的环节之一。Java提供了多种数据分析工具和框架,如Apache Spark和Apache Flink等,这些工具提供了丰富的数据处理和分析功能,支持批处理和流处理,能够处理大规模数据集并运行复杂的分析算法。此外,Java的函数式编程特性和Lambda表达式等功能也使得数据分析过程更加灵活和高效。
2.4 数据存储
在大数据处理完成后,数据需要进行持久化存储。Java可以通过多种方式存储数据,如存储到关系型数据库、NoSQL数据库以及分布式文件系统等。Java提供了多种数据库操作接口和ORM框架,如JDBC和Hibernate等,方便开发人员对数据进行存储、查询和操作。
3. Java在大数据方向的优势
Java作为一门成熟而强大的编程语言,在大数据领域有着诸多优势。
3.1 跨平台性
Java具有良好的跨平台性,可以在不同的操作系统上运行。这使得开发人员可以轻松地将Java应用部署到不同的大数据平台上,并实现对集群中的数据进行处理和分析。
3.2 强大的类库和框架支持
Java拥有丰富的类库和框架支持,如Hadoop、Spark和Flink等。这些工具和框架提供了高效的数据处理和分析能力,能够快速开发大规模数据处理应用。
3.3 多线程和并发编程
Java具备强大的多线程和并发编程特性,能够更好地利用系统资源,提高大数据处理的效率。多线程和并发编程在处理大规模数据时尤为重要,能够加快数据处理速度,提升系统性能。
3.4 面向对象和异常处理
Java的面向对象特性使得代码更易读、易维护,有助于开发人员编写灵活和可靠的大数据处理算法。同时,Java的异常处理机制也能够提高代码的健壮性,有效处理可能出现的错误情况。
3.5 社区支持和生态系统
Java拥有庞大的开发者社区和完善的生态系统,开发人员可以获得大量的技术支持和资源。众多开源项目和活跃的社区为Java在大数据领域的应用提供了更多的可能性。
4. 总结
Java在大数据方向具有广泛的应用和重要的地位,能够帮助开发人员处理海量数据、进行数据分析和实现智能决策。Java的跨平台性、丰富的类库和框架支持、多线程和并发编程特性以及面向对象和异常处理机制等优势,使得Java成为大数据处理的首选语言之一。随着大数据技术的不断发展,相信Java在大数据领域的应用将会更加广泛和深入。
三、学习java以后的就业方向有哪些?
1,可以开发手机,现在手机app很火热这么面的东西比如很多工资不低
2,可以开发平板电脑系统软件,因为平板电脑是安卓系统和手机系统一样这方面的工作应该很多
3,可以开发window系统软件,可以快速开发
4,可以做游戏编程,很多游戏引擎和脚本都可以用java来写
5,做web网站java里面的jsp可以写网站脚本
6,一般企业里面用的软件java都可以开发
7,一些银行,电信,保险这些要求安全高的公司,需要用java开发软件
四、医学大数据就业方向?
大数据专业毕业生未来的岗位选择空间还是比较大的,有三大类岗位可以选择,分别是大数据开发岗位、大数据分析岗位和大数据运维岗位,在不同的行业和技术体系结构下,这些岗位也包含很多细分的岗位。
大数据开发岗位是当前人才需求量比较大的岗位之一,不论是本科生还是研究生,当前选择大数据开发岗位会有相对较大的选择空间。
五、数据科学专业就业方向?
数据科学与大数据技术专业具体就业方向
1.大数据系统架构师
大数据平台搭建、系统设计、基础设施。
2.大数据系统分析师
面向实际行业领域,利用大数据技术进行数据安全生命周期管理、分析和应用。
3.hadoop开发工程师。
解决大数据存储问题。
4.数据分析师
不同行业中,专门从事行业数据搜集、整理、分析,并依据数据做出行业研究、评估和预测的专业人员。在工作中通过运用工具,提取、分析、呈现数据,实现数据的商业意义。
作为一名数据分析师,至少需要熟练SPSS、STATISTIC、Eviews、SAS、大数据魔镜等数据分析软件中的一门,至少能用Acess等进行数据库开发,至少掌握一门数学软件如matalab、mathmatics进行新模型的构建,至少掌握一门编程语言。总之,一个优秀的数据分析师,应该业务、管理、分析、工具、设计都不落下。
2数据科学与大数据技术专业简介
数据科学与大数据技术专业以统计学、数学、计算机为三大支撑性学科;生物、医学、环境科学、经济学、社会学、管理学为应用拓展性学科。此外还需学习数据采集、分析、处理软件,学习数学建模软件及计算机编程语言等,知识结构是二专多能复合的跨界人才(有专业知识、有数据思维)。
不同院校开设此专业,培养模式会有差异。有些会更多偏向于工具的使用,如数据清洗、数据存储以及数据可视化等相关工具的使用;有些会倾向于大数据相关基础知识全面覆盖性教学,在研究生段则会专攻某一技术领域,比如数据挖掘、数据分析、商业智能、人工智能等。
六、大数据最佳就业方向?
大数据专业是从数据管理、系统开发、海量数据分析和挖掘等方面系统,帮助企业掌握大数据应用中各种典型问题的解决方案的专业,就业方向数据开发与管理、企业管理、城市环境治理等方面。可以去上海市大数据股份有限公司、辉略(上海)大数据科技有限公司、成都市大数据股份有限公司、青岛星链数据技术有限公司、阿里云计算有限公司、华为云计算技术有限公司等。
七、大数据专业就业方向?
大数据专业主要的三大就业方向:
大数据系统研发类人才、大数据应用开发类人才和大数据分析类人才。
十大职位:
一、ETL研发;
二、Hadoop开发;
三、可视化(前端展现)工具开发;
四、信息架构开发;
五、数据仓库研究;
六、OLAP开发;
七、数据科学研究;
八、数据预测(数据挖掘)分析;
九、企业数据管理;
十、数据安全研究。
比较常见的有:
大数据产品分析专员、大数据客户分析专员、大数据市场分析专员、大数据运营分析专员、 证劵数据分析师、互联网金融分析师、大数据算法工程师、大数据可视化工程师、大数据分析工程师
八、java大数据就业
大数据(Big Data)已经成为当今世界的热门话题,越来越多的公司和组织开始关注如何利用大数据来进行业务分析和决策。而在这个大数据时代,掌握Java编程技能,尤其是掌握Java大数据技术,将会为就业增加更多的机会和竞争力。
Java大数据技术的重要性
Java作为一门广泛应用于企业级开发的编程语言,已经在大数据领域崭露头角。随着数据量的不断增长和数据种类的多样化,Java大数据技术的需求也日益增加。掌握Java大数据技术,可以帮助企业高效地处理海量数据,并从中获取有价值的信息和洞察。
Java大数据技术的重要性体现在以下几个方面:
- 生态系统完备:Java有着丰富的开源生态系统,包括Hadoop、Spark、Flink等流行的大数据框架,这些框架提供了处理大数据的强大工具和技术。
- 高性能和可伸缩性:Java语言具有出色的性能和可伸缩性,可以处理大规模的数据集并实现高效的数据分析。
- 企业级支持和稳定性:Java是一门可靠和稳定的编程语言,已经在众多企业级应用中得到广泛应用,因此掌握Java大数据技术可以为企业提供稳定的数据处理和分析解决方案。
Java大数据技术的应用领域
Java大数据技术可以应用于多个领域,包括但不限于以下几个方面:
- 商业智能与数据分析:通过Java大数据技术,企业可以对海量的销售数据、用户数据等进行分析,从而获得有关市场趋势、消费者行为等方面的洞察,为业务决策提供有力支持。
- 金融行业:Java大数据技术可以帮助金融机构进行风险评估、欺诈检测和交易分析,从而提高业务效率和降低风险。
- 电子商务:通过Java大数据技术,电商企业可以对用户行为、商品销售等进行分析,提供个性化推荐、营销策略优化等服务。
- 物联网:Java大数据技术可以处理物联网设备产生的海量数据,并实现设备管理、故障预测等功能。
- 社交媒体:Java大数据技术可以帮助社交媒体平台进行用户行为分析、内容推荐等,提升用户体验和平台粘性。
学习Java大数据技术的路径和工具
想要学习Java大数据技术,需要掌握以下几个方面的知识:
- Java编程基础:学习Java大数据技术之前,需要先掌握Java编程的基本语法和概念,包括变量、数据类型、循环和条件语句等。
- 数据库技术:掌握数据库的基本操作和SQL语言,可以帮助存储和管理大数据。
- 大数据框架:学习Hadoop、Spark等大数据框架的基本原理和使用方法,了解它们的生态系统和工作机制。
- 数据分析和挖掘:了解数据分析和挖掘的基本概念和方法,包括数据清洗、特征提取、模型建立等。
在学习Java大数据技术过程中,可以利用一些常用的工具和资源:
- IDE:使用集成开发环境(IDE)如Eclipse或IntelliJ IDEA,可以提高Java编码的效率和质量。
- 在线教育平台:通过在线教育平台如Coursera、edX、网易云课堂等,可以找到相关的课程和学习资源,学习Java大数据技术。
- 开源社区:参与开源社区如Apache的Hadoop、Spark等项目,可以与其他开发者交流经验,学习最新的开发技术和解决方案。
Java大数据就业前景
随着大数据技术的全面应用,对掌握Java大数据技术的专业人士的需求也在不断增长。掌握Java大数据技术可以为个人带来以下几个方面的就业机会和前景:
- 大数据工程师:负责搭建和维护大数据平台,开发数据处理和分析的应用程序。
- 数据分析师:通过Java大数据技术分析和挖掘数据,为企业提供有价值的商业洞察。
- 数据科学家:利用Java大数据技术和机器学习算法对数据进行建模和预测,提供数据驱动的解决方案。
- 解决方案架构师:设计和构建大数据解决方案,为企业提供高性能和可扩展的数据处理和分析平台。
总之,Java大数据技术在当今的大数据时代具有重要的应用和发展前景。掌握Java大数据技术不仅可以为个人增加就业机会,还可以为企业提供高效、稳定和可扩展的数据处理和分析解决方案。
九、数据科学与大数据技术就业方向?
数据科学和大数据技术是当前非常热门的领域,就业前景非常广阔。以下是数据科学和大数据技术的就业方向:
数据分析师:负责收集、整理和清洗数据,使用统计学和计算机科学知识进行分析,为客户提供数据分析和建议。
数据工程师:负责构建和维护数据仓库、数据湖和高斯模糊数据库,为业务提供数据采集、存储、处理和分析服务。
机器学习工程师:负责构建机器学习模型,包括监督学习、无监督学习和深度学习,以解决各种实际问题。
数据挖掘工程师:负责使用各种算法和技术,如聚类、分类、关联规则挖掘、文本挖掘等,从海量数据中提取有价值的信息。
大数据开发工程师:负责构建大数据应用系统,包括数据采集、存储、处理、分析和展示等。
人工智能工程师:负责构建人工智能模型,包括自然语言处理、图像处理、语音识别等,以解决各种实际问题。
以上仅是数据科学和大数据技术的部分就业方向,随着技术的不断发展和应用场景的增多,未来还会有更多的就业机会。
十、java的大数据方向
Java的大数据方向
随着互联网时代的到来,大数据已经成为当今企业发展和决策的关键因素之一。在这个信息爆炸的时代,Java作为一种广泛使用的编程语言,也在大数据领域发挥着重要作用。Java的灵活性、可靠性和强大的生态系统使其成为大数据处理的首选语言之一。
Java提供了丰富的库和框架,可以帮助开发人员处理大数据。接下来,我将介绍一些Java在大数据领域的重要方向和相关技术。
1. Hadoop和MapReduce
Hadoop和MapReduce是处理大数据的重要工具和框架。Hadoop是一个分布式计算框架,可以将大量数据分成小块,并将其分散到集群中的多个节点上进行处理。而MapReduce是一种编程模型,用于编写在Hadoop集群中运行的并行处理任务。
对于Java开发人员而言,掌握Hadoop和MapReduce是非常重要的。通过使用Java编写MapReduce作业,可以利用Hadoop的分布式计算能力,高效处理海量数据。
2. Spark
Spark是一个快速、通用的集群计算系统,它提供了一个容易使用的API,用于在大数据集上进行并行计算。与Hadoop相比,Spark具有更高的性能和更好的编程模型。
Java开发人员可以利用Spark提供的Java API,编写并行计算任务。Spark支持各种数据源和数据处理操作,包括图计算、机器学习和流处理等,使得Java开发人员能够灵活地处理和分析大数据集。
3. Storm
Storm是一个分布式实时计算系统,可以在大规模数据流上进行可扩展的实时数据处理。它提供了一个容错的、高度可靠的计算平台,适用于处理实时数据流。
Java开发人员可以使用Storm的Java API编写流式计算拓扑。Storm提供了丰富的操作和组件,用于实时数据处理、数据过滤以及高级的流式数据分析。通过掌握Storm,Java开发人员可以在大规模实时数据环境中快速构建和调试流式计算应用。
4. Kafka
Kafka是一个高吞吐量的分布式消息队列系统,使用可持久化日志来保证容错性。它可以处理大量的并发消息,并将其广播到订阅者中。Kafka被广泛应用于大数据处理和实时数据流处理。
Java开发人员可以使用Kafka提供的Java API和客户端库来读取和写入大量的消息数据。通过将Kafka与其他大数据工具和框架集成,可以构建高效的数据流处理系统。
5. HBase
HBase是一个高性能、可扩展的分布式列存储系统。它构建在Hadoop之上,提供了对大规模结构化和半结构化数据的随机实时访问。
Java开发人员可以使用HBase的Java API来操作和管理分布式数据表。HBase具有高度可靠性和可伸缩性,适用于存储大量的实时数据,并支持复杂的查询和分析操作。
6. Flume
Flume是一个分布式、可靠的日志收集和聚合系统。它可以从多个数据源收集数据,并将其传输到目标存储或计算系统中。
Java开发人员可以使用Flume提供的Java API编写数据收集和传输任务。通过使用Flume,可以方便地收集和聚合大量的数据,为后续的数据处理和分析提供基础。
总结
Java在大数据领域具有广泛的应用和重要的地位。掌握Java的大数据方向,对于Java开发人员来说是非常有竞争力的优势。通过学习和掌握Hadoop、Spark、Storm、Kafka、HBase和Flume等关键技术,Java开发人员可以更好地处理和分析大数据,为企业的发展和决策提供有力支持。
希望本文对对Java开发人员在大数据领域的学习和发展有所帮助。大数据时代已经来临,作为开发人员,不断学习和掌握新的技术将是不可或缺的能力。相信通过不断的努力和实践,你将在大数据领域取得更多的成就!